Block 573,246

Block Hash

e3b8f0cdebcb53a1ed36d64b650d2c0b4d747ff21f43a1993ebc83a9e086eac7

Previous Block Hash

fdbd71fa36b78d15a541d574f8309eccaa55bbc70927027c9a02056602cbe64f

Mined

Transactions

3

Difficulty

34.83 M

Size

623 bytes

Transactions (3)

1 input, 1 output
15,625.00452 PEPE
1 input, 2 outputs
53,013.76958 PEPE
1 input, 2 outputs
29,677.1612 PEPE